2010-10-15 36 views
0

J'ai un projet d'installation en VisualStudio 2005.projet de déploiement: lire une variable de configuration à partir du Registre

L'utilisateur est invité à remplir l'adresse du serveur qui sera stocké dans une clé de Registre.

Maintenant, je voudrais que si l'utilisateur réinstalle ce projet, que l'ancien nom de serveur soit proposé par défaut comme valeur dans l'interface de configuration.

Est-il possible de conserver l'ancienne valeur de la clé de registre, de la proposer dans une nouvelle configuration?

Répondre

0

Oui. Ne supprimez simplement pas la clé lorsque vous désinstallez le programme. Ce qui signifie que vous ne sauvegardez pas votre clé là où les paramètres de l'application sauvent, c'est-à-dire créez la clé vous-même. Vous voudrez également vérifier si vous voulez cette clé pour tous les utilisateurs ou une pour chaque utilisateur et les autorisations que votre choix affecte.

+0

heh. laissant la clé est OK, maintenant la partie la plus difficile est de le lire dans l'interface de configuration ... – serhio